Macadamia nuts are rich, buttery-flavored nuts native to Australia. They are prized for their creamy texture and high nutritional value, making them a popular choice for both snacking and cooking. These nuts are loaded with healthy fats, antioxidants, and essential nutrients, contributing to their reputation as a superfood.

These nuts are native to Australia and are often used in a variety of culinary applications, from baking to savory dishes. Their high fat content, primarily monounsaturated fats, makes them a heart-healthy choice that can help lower bad cholesterol levels.
Incorporating macadamia nuts into your diet can provide numerous health benefits. They are a great source of fiber, protein, and essential vitamins and minerals, including magnesium, iron, and vitamin B6. What are macadamia nuts?
Macadamia nuts are rich, buttery-flavored nuts that are native to Australia and known for their creamy texture and high nutritional value.
Are macadamia nuts healthy?
Yes, macadamia nuts are healthy as they are rich in monounsaturated fats, fiber, and essential vitamins and minerals, contributing to heart health and overall wellness.
